1 mogen
I 〈 hulpwerkwoord〉1 [toestemming/recht/vrijheid hebben] can ⇒ be allowed to, 〈 tegenwoordig tijd of indirecte rede〉 may, 〈 met ontkenning〉 must, 〈 in voorwaardelijke wijs〉 should, 〈 in voorwaardelijke wijs〉 ought to3 [met betrekking tot toegeving] may, might4 [met betrekking tot een mogelijkheid] should5 [kunnen] 〈zie voorbeelden 5〉6 [met betrekking tot een wens] 〈zie voorbeelden 6〉♦voorbeelden:1 mag ik een kilo peren van u? • (can I have) two pounds of pears, pleasemag ik uw naam even? • could/may I have your name, please?mag Deirdre blijven spelen? • can Deirdre stay and play?je mag gaan spelen, maar je mag je niet vuil maken • you can go out and play, but you're not to get dirtyer mag hier niet gerookt worden • you're not allowed to smoke hereals ik vragen mag • if you don't mind my askingu mag hier even wachten • please take a seatdat mag ik niet zeggen • I'm not at liberty/allowed to tell youmag het een onsje meer zijn? • do you mind if it's a bit more?mag ik zo vrij zijn? • do you mind?alles mag toch maar vandaag de dag • anything goes nowadaysmag ik alsjeblieft? • do you mind? 〈nadruk op ‘mind’〉ik mag het eigenlijk niet vertellen • I'm not really supposed to tell youmag ik even? • do you mind?, may I?mag ik er even langs? • excuse me (please)dat mag niet • that's not allowed; 〈 tegen de regels〉 that's against the rules; 〈 tegen de wet〉 that's illegalvan mij mag het • it's alright by mevan mij mag het een maand duren • I don't mind if it takes a/another monthhij wou meekomen maar hij mocht niet van zijn moeder • he wanted to come along but his mother wouldn't let him2 dat mag ook wel eens gezegd worden • there's no harm in saying that, tooje had me wel eens mogen waarschuwen • you might/could have warned meik mag niet mopperen • I mustn't complainje mag je wel eens scheren • you could do with a shaveje mag wel uitkijken, het is glad op straat • you'd better/you should be careful, it's slippery outhij mag blij zijn dat … • he ought to/should be happy that …wat een mooie jas! dat mag ook wel voor dat geld • what a lovely coat! it ought to/should be at that pricehij mag dan slim zijn, sterk is hij niet • he may be clever, but he isn't strongdat mag dan zo zijn, maar … • that may well be (so), but …; granted, but …hoe dat ook moge zijn • be that as it may4 mocht dat het geval zijn, … • should that be the case, …; if so, …5 het mocht niet baten • it was no use/gooddat ik dit nog mag meemaken! • that I should live to see this!het heeft niet zo mogen zijn • it was not to be6 moge dit jaar u veel geluk brengen • 〈 algemeen, bijvoorbeeld met betrekking tot schooljaar〉 I hope you will be very happy in the coming yearlang moge hij heersen • long may he reignzo mag ik het horen/zien • that's what I like (to hear/see), that's the spirithij mag er zijn • 〈 algemeen〉 he's quite a guy; 〈 heeft kwaliteiten〉 he's got what it takes; 〈is groot/flink van postuur〉 he's a big guy/; 〈 is knap〉 he's some guyhet mocht wat • it doesn't mean a thingik mag graag een sigaartje roken • I like/enjoy a nice cigarII 〈 overgankelijk werkwoord〉1 [sympathiek vinden] like♦voorbeelden:1 ik mag hem wel • I quite/rather like himzij is een beetje arrogant, maar dat mag ik wel • she's a bit arrogant but I like them that way -
